1. In clowning, there is a hierarchy, with the White Face clown at the high end and the  _________ at the low end.

A) hobo

B) class clown

C) girl clown

D) Auguste clown

 

2. Would-be clowns can imitate another clown in everything except the

A) clothes

B) act

C) hairdo

D) face

 

3. To trademark a clown face, a clown sends a photo of his/her face into the Clown Registry, where the face is then painted on a _____________ and kept in the registry.

A) 12x16 inch canvas

B) wall

C) goose egg

D) glass

 

4. In order to join the Moscow State Circus, clowns must go to the Moscow State Circus College for Circus and Variety Arts for ________________ .

A) 7 years

B) 8 months

C) 2 years

D) 4 years

 

5. What famous clown was originally created by Capitol Records in the 1940s as a character featured in a series of children's records?

A) Bozo
B) Weepy Willie
C) Koko
D) Clarabelle
 

6. Santa Claus is the most widely recognized face in the world.  Who comes in second?

A) Bozo

B) Emmett Kelly

C) Ronald McDonald

D) Clem Kadiddlehopper

7. Emmett Kelly was a famous clown with the Ringling Bros. and Barnum & Bailey Circus. What was the name of his classic clown character?
A) Lonely Louie
B) Sad Sam
C) Weary Willie
D) Forlorn Fred

8. Red Skelton’s characters included all the following except:

A) Clem Kadiddlehopper and Sheriff Deadeye

B) Freddy the Freeloader and the Mean Widdle Kid

C) Puff-a-Lump and Paddy McPugg

D) San Fernando Red and Bolivar Shagnasty

 

9. Known as “America’s Favorite Clown”, Red Skelton signed of from his shows with

A) “Good night, and God bless”

B) “Now it’s time to say good-bye”

C) “Thanks for sharing a laugh or two”

D) “See you next week”

Answers

1. A) hobo

2. D) face

3. C) goose egg

4. A) 7 years

5. A) Bozo

6. C) Ronald McDonald

7. C) Weary Willie

8. C) Puff-a-Lump and Paddy McPugg

9. A) “Good night, and God bless”
